What a Guard House Shade Contractor Does

A guard house shade contractor in Eastern Province helps you turn a small security post into a cooler, safer place to work through long summer shifts. In Al Khobar, Dammam, Dhahran, Jubail and nearby coastal sites, guard houses sit right in the sun, so a well-designed shade is more than a cosmetic add-on. It reduces direct heat, cuts glare for the guard, and helps the entry point look cared for from the street.

We design and build guard house shades that suit the site, the wind conditions and the surrounding architecture. At CI Shade, our team works across Saudi Arabia and Bahrain, with the kind of workmanship needed for Eastern Province heat, dust, coastal salt and the day-to-day wear that comes with busy entrances.

Why Choose the Right Guard House Shade?

A guard house is often the first contact point on a site, and people notice it straight away. If the shade is undersized, badly angled or built with the wrong fabric, the guard ends up dealing with glare, trapped heat and a tired-looking entrance. The right structure improves comfort, gives the security team better visibility, and keeps the post looking consistent with the rest of the property.

Built for the Gulf sun and salt air

In the Eastern Province and Bahrain, the sun is punishing for most of the year, and coastal air brings salt exposure that can age weak materials quickly. We specify shading solutions that suit these conditions, with fabric and steel details chosen for practical outdoor use. That matters on refinery-adjacent sites, industrial compounds, residential communities and commercial entrances where the guard house is exposed every day.

Custom design for a small footprint

Guard houses rarely have generous space around them. Some need a cantilevered canopy so the entrance stays clear; others need a wraparound shade that covers waiting visitors without blocking vehicle movement. Our design & engineering team measures the site, checks the mounting points and shapes the structure to fit the actual layout, not a generic drawing.

Designed Around Visibility

A guard post needs shelter without becoming dark or boxed in. We shape the shade so the guard still has a clear view of incoming vehicles and pedestrians, while the seating area stays protected from direct sun. That balance is one of the small details that makes a site work better every day.

How We Handle a Guard House Shade Project

Every guard house is slightly different, so we begin with the site as it is, not a standard catalogue shape. From there, our team moves through a straightforward sequence that keeps the work organised and the details tight.

  1. Site review and measurements. We look at the guard house size, vehicle turning space, access lanes and nearby structures. If the entrance is exposed to strong wind or coastal spray, we account for that in the layout.
  2. Concept design and engineering. Our design team prepares the shade form, steel arrangement and fixing points. For more demanding sites, we complete structural engineering and detailing so the structure suits the load conditions and the actual footprint.
  3. Fabrication in our facility. The steel members, brackets and supporting parts are fabricated in our own production facility. That gives better control over alignment, weld quality and the final fit before anything reaches site.
  4. On-site installation and finishing. Our crews install the shade under supervision, coordinate with site management and complete the finishing work cleanly. If the guard house is part of a larger entrance package, we coordinate it with the wider front-of-house works.

Materials and Build Options for Guard House Shades

For guard houses, the material choice needs to suit both appearance and endurance. We commonly work with PVC coated fabric, PVDF coated fabric and HDPE fabric, depending on the look, the exposure level and the ventilation needed. Where the structure calls for a more rigid architectural finish, steel detailing becomes just as important as the membrane itself. In exposed Eastern Province locations, fixing details, drainage and corrosion-aware steelwork can matter as much as the visible canopy shape.

Material Best Use on Guard Houses Main Benefit
PVC coated fabricGeneral entry canopies and compact post shadesPractical all-round option with dependable weather protection
PVDF coated fabricFront entrances where appearance mattersCleaner finish and strong resistance for demanding outdoor use
HDPE fabricBreathable shades where airflow is helpfulReduces direct sun while keeping the area ventilated
Structural steelworkCantilevered or framed guard house shade structuresProvides the backbone for stable, site-specific installation

What we look at before recommending a material

The same guard house can call for a different solution in two nearby sites. A police or security post at a busy industrial gate may need a tougher steel arrangement, while a residential community entrance might place more weight on appearance and visitor comfort. We also think about cleaning access, cable routes, nearby cameras and how the shade will look from the road.
